This product is used in my 2009 CR TDI. Before anyone starts to say that this is not 507.00 specified by VW, I want to say I know. I started using the 5W-40 interchangeably with the 5W-30, and they are almost identical products. A 5W-40 motor oil cannot be labeled under 507.00, but these are very similar formulations. There are many TDI owners who have been running this oil for a while in their CR engines with no issues. Both Mobil 1 ESP formulas are used commonly in the CR engine, and you can spend days researching this online with no clear winner. This is a very good product. Both have a sulfated ash content of 0.6%, which extends life of the DPF. The viscosity difference between these 30 and 40 weight oils are 3.6 vs. 3.8 cP, respectively. They almost overlap.

Mobil 1 ESP Formula M 5w40 is a quality product. This is a synthetic motor oil with a low ash formula, to protect the emissions systems of today's complex diesel vehicles.

Specifically, this oil is for use in today's diesel powered Mercedes automobiles.

It should be noted that some dealers have accidentally (if that is the term) used this diesel spec oil, 229.51 in gasoline spec cars.

Gasoline cars require Mercedes spec 229.5. The spec numbers may look similar, but they are indeed different.

The gasoline version have many more additives in them, to keep the oil suitable for long service intervals that Mercedes advises.

There is also a non-ESP version of Formula M that some dealers use in gasoline cars, which is indeed approved. However, you will not the gasoline application version of Formula M for consumer retail commonly. Therefore, if you see a Formula M on a regular store's shelves, it likely this diesel, ESP formula, which is not for your gasoline Mercedes.

The easiest to find 229.5 spec Mercedes approved oil for gasoline powered cars is Mobil 1 0w40.

Please keep this QUALITY product for use only in your diesel powered Mercedes. It serves that application beautifully!

Since the first SAE number refers to cold viscosity ("W"inter), it meets the VW spec on cold viscosity same as the ESP 5W-30 (VW certified oil). The second number refers to hot viscosity tested at 210F/100C degrees. Unfortunately, the SAE standard itself is not precise due to the variance range it allows. While other brands may have significant variance from 30 to 40, these two products do not. Mobile 1 data says the 30 has a low sheer viscosity of 12.1 cSt, while the 40 has 13.4 cSt (11% difference). In my opinion, the 30 is actually worse for the engine and this is why: The newer HTHS (High Temperature High Sheer) test is performed at 302F/150C degrees. Turbocharged engines in their high stress/pressure areas can approach these temperatures. The 30 tested at 3.58 mPa*s and the 40 at 3.8 mPa*s (a higher number equals better engine wear protection). The trade off is that it slightly lowers fuel efficiency and this is why most manufacturers are lowering their viscosity recommendations. They have government agencies pressuring them to increase fuel efficiency but we the owners are losing engine longevity similar to what ethanol is doing. If this oil was harmful to common rail diesels, Mercedes would not be recommending it. Instead, Mercedes is putting its customer's engine longevity before minor mpg gains (basically telling the EPA to take a hike).
